Mauritius Island, like a local
Don't miss
- Le Morne Brabant: A UNESCO World Heritage site with stunning views and historical significance.
- Seven Colored Earths: A unique geological formation showcasing vibrant colors.
- Botanical Garden: Home to endemic plant species and giant water lilies.
- Île aux Cerfs: A paradise island known for its beautiful beaches and water sports.
Where to eat
- Dhal Puri: A traditional Mauritian flatbread stuffed with lentils, a must-try local dish.
- Rougaille: A flavorful tomato-based dish often served with fish or meat, embodying local spices.
- Gateaux Piments: Spicy lentil cakes that are a popular street food snack.
Do this
- Underwater Sea Walk: An unforgettable experience walking on the ocean floor surrounded by marine life.
- Cultural Village Tour: A deep dive into the diverse cultures and traditions of Mauritius.
- Hiking in Black River Gorges: Explore stunning landscapes and endemic wildlife in Mauritius' national park.
Local tips
- Visit local markets early in the morning for the freshest produce and local delicacies.
- Try to learn a few phrases in French or Creole; locals appreciate the effort.
- Avoid the tourist traps and seek local eateries for authentic Mauritian cuisine.
- Public transport is reliable and affordable; use buses for a local commuting experience.
Know before you go
Best time
Apr-Jun, Sep-Oct. These months offer pleasant weather with lower humidity and less rainfall, ideal for outdoor activities and beach relaxation.
Getting around
Public buses, taxis, and rental cars are the primary means of transport. Buses are affordable, while taxis and car rentals offer more convenience.
Airport
MRU
Language
English, French, and Mauritian Creole.
Money
Mauritian Rupee (MUR). Credit cards are widely accepted, but carrying cash for smaller establishments is advisable.
Safety
Mauritius is generally safe for tourists, with low crime rates, but standard precautions should still be observed.
